Step-by-step explanation:
I'm assuming the question is asking to solve for variable x.
The two red arrows signify the two lines are congruent, meaning they equal the same measurement.
In other words:
23x - 5 = 21x + 5
Isolate the variable x
Add 5 to both sides to cancel 5 from the left side
23x - 5 + 5 = 21x + 5 + 5
23x + 0 = 21x + 10
23x = 21x + 10
Subtract 21x from both sides to cancel 21x from the right side
23x - 21x = 21x - 21x + 10
2x = 0x + 10
2x = 10
Divide both sides by 2 to isolate the variable x
2x ÷ 2 = 10 ÷ 2
x = 5
When solving for these types of problems, always isolate the variable. Also, keep in mind that whatever you do to one side, you must do to the other (such as how I added 5 to <em>both</em> sides).
